How long does it take to become a certified financial planner?

Typically, it takes 18-24 months to become a CFP® professional, but the certification process offers flexibility so you can make it work for you.

What degree do you need to be a certified financial planner?

You’ll need to meet certain requirements before you get certified, such as education, how you do on the CFP exam, work experience and your professional ethics. To meet the education threshold, you must have a bachelor degree by an accredited university.

How many hours study for CFP?

250 hours
CFP Board recommends you spend at least 250 hours studying for the exam. While that sounds overwhelming, the time goes pretty quickly between pre-study, the Candidate Handbook, required education courses, question bank time, review, practice exams, and your own preparations.

What kind of exam do you need to be a financial planner?

But you will need to pass some form of exam to be a financial planner. The Financial Industry Regulatory Authority (FINRA) offers a series of exams that allow those who pass to perform different financial services, like selling securities.

How many years of financial planning experience do you need?

You need to complete either 6,000 hours of professional experience related to the financial planning process, or 4,000 hours of apprenticeship experience that meets additional requirements. Experience must be completed within 10 years before and 5 years after successful completion of the CFP® exam.
